t a hockey game, a vender sold a combined total of 231 sodas and hot dogs. The number of sodas sold was two times the number of hot dogs sold. Find the number of sodas and the number of hot dogs sold.

Respuesta :

rocket3989 rocket3989
  • 02-10-2018
sodas+hot dogs = 231

hotdogs* 2 = sodas

substitute,

hotdogs*2 +hotdogs= 231

3*hotdogs = 231

hotdogs = 77

sodas = 154
